SBA Administrator Linda McMahon Honors Top Resource Partners During National Small Business Week


WASHINGTON, April 26, 2018 /PRNewswire-USNewswire/ -- SBA Administrator Linda McMahon will recognize the 2018 National Small Business Week resource partner award winners in Washington, D.C. on Sunday, April 29 to kickoff day one of National Small Business Week celebrations, taking place across the nation.  Administrator McMahon will present awards to a Pittsburgh Women's Business Center, a Virginia Veterans Business Outreach Center, a Colorado Small Business Development Center and a Pennsylvania SCORE Chapter for their positive impact on the creation and growth of small businesses in the U.S.

Administrator McMahon will take part in the national awards ceremonies before embarking on a multi-city bus tour to highlight the nation's most outstanding business owners during National Small Business Week, April 29-May 5.

Each year, the SBA counsels, trains and advises more than one million entrepreneurs and small business owners, with the help of its resource partners that provide access to capital, invaluable resources, business know-how, and the right expertise for each stage of a business's lifecycle.  Their exceptional efforts provided to entrepreneurs help to power the engine of the nation's economy.  It is shown that entrepreneurs receiving resource partner assistance are more likely to start a business and successfully obtain financing necessary for business growth.

Key factors in determining the resource partner award winners were excellence and innovation in assisting small businesses, overall client satisfaction and collaboration with local, state and other entities, market penetration, and outreach in providing strong education efforts and relevant counseling and training services to small businesses.

The 2018 resource partner award winners are:

Women's Business Center of Excellence Award
Chatham's Women's Business Center
Anne Flynn Schlicht, WBC Director
Pittsburgh, Pa.

Veterans Business Outreach Center Excellence in Service Award
Veterans Business Outreach Center at Community Business Partnership
Charles McCaffrey, Executive Director
Springfield, Va.

Small Business Development Service Excellence and Innovation Award
Boulder Small Business Development Center
Sharon King, Executive Director
Boulder, Colo.

SCORE Chapter of the Year
SCORE Lancaster-Lebanon
Robert (Bobb) S. Bewley, Chapter President
Julie E. Poland, District Director 
Lancaster, Pa.

Each year since 1963, the president has issued a proclamation calling for the celebration of National Small Business Week.  This year National Small Business Week will be recognized April 29 ? May 5, with events planned in Washington, D.C., Florida, Georgia, South Carolina and North Carolina.
